DTF Transfer Storage: How to Store Transfers So They Press Like New

Most DTF transfer problems do not start at the heat press. They start quietly in storage. A transfer that was printed perfectly can lose adhesion strength, color density, or consistency simply from being stored the wrong way. By the time the issue shows up during pressing, the damage has already been done.

This guide explains DTF transfer storage in practical terms. You will learn how to store DTF transfers, how long they last, what environmental factors matter most, and how to avoid the common storage mistakes that lead to peeling, cracking, or dull prints. The goal is simple: keep your transfers pressing like new, even if they sit for weeks before use.

What Proper DTF Transfer Storage Prevents

DTF transfers are not fragile, but they are sensitive. The film, ink layer, and adhesive are all designed to activate under heat and pressure. When stored incorrectly, those layers can slowly degrade without any visible warning.

Proper DTF transfer storage helps prevent:

  • Edge lifting or peeling after pressing
  • Uneven adhesion across the design
  • Faded or muted colors compared to the original print
  • Cracking along creases or bent areas
  • Transfers that feel tacky or brittle before pressing

Many press operators assume these problems come from temperature or pressure settings. In reality, storage is often the root cause. Once a transfer has been compromised in storage, no amount of pressing adjustment will fully fix it.

What You Need for Correct DTF Transfer Storage

You do not need expensive equipment or climate controlled rooms to store DTF transfers correctly. You do need consistency and a basic understanding of what harms transfers over time.

At a minimum, proper DTF transfer storage requires:

  • A flat surface or rigid container that prevents bending
  • A dry environment with stable humidity
  • Room temperature storage without extreme swings
  • Protection from direct light, dust, and pressure
  • A simple system for tracking how long transfers have been stored

Storage failures usually happen when transfers are treated as paper instead of as a layered print product. Tossing sheets into a drawer, stacking heavy boxes on top, or leaving them in a garage are all common mistakes that quietly shorten DTF transfer shelf life.

How to Store DTF Transfers Step by Step

Step 1: Store DTF Transfers Flat, Not Rolled

The most important rule of DTF transfer storage is to keep transfers flat. Rolling transfers into tubes or allowing them to curl introduces memory into the film. Even if the transfer looks flat later, micro curves can affect how pressure is applied during pressing.

Creases are even more damaging. A hard bend can permanently weaken adhesion along that line, leading to cracking or peeling after washing.

Best options for flat storage include:

  • Flat drawers or shelves
  • Rigid folders with cardboard backing
  • Flat storage boxes designed for prints

Avoid hanging transfers, rolling them, or stacking them loosely where they can slide and bend.

Storing DTF transfers flat in rigid folders

Step 2: Control Humidity Around Stored Transfers

Humidity is one of the biggest threats to DTF transfer shelf life. Excess moisture can weaken the adhesive layer before heat is ever applied. This often leads to poor bonding or peeling edges during pressing.

Humidity problems are common in:

  • Garages
  • Basements
  • Laundry rooms
  • Coastal or high moisture climates

If a transfer feels tacky, limp, or slightly sticky before pressing, humidity exposure is a likely cause.

To protect against moisture:

  • Store transfers in a dry room whenever possible
  • Use sealed containers for longer storage
  • Add desiccant packs if your environment is naturally humid

Step 3: Maintain the Right DTF Transfer Storage Temperature

DTF transfer storage temperature should stay close to normal indoor room temperature. Extreme heat or cold can stress both the film and adhesive layers.

High temperatures may soften adhesive prematurely, while cold temperatures can make film brittle. Repeated temperature swings are especially harmful because materials expand and contract over time.

Avoid storing DTF transfers:

  • Inside vehicles
  • Near heaters or heat presses
  • In uninsulated sheds or storage units

Stable temperature is more important than hitting an exact number. Consistency helps transfers remain predictable when pressed.

Step 4: Protect Transfers From Light, Dust, and Pressure

Direct light exposure can slowly affect ink vibrancy, especially when transfers sit for extended periods. Dust and debris can contaminate adhesive surfaces, creating weak spots that show up as dull or uneven areas after pressing.

Pressure damage is another overlooked issue. Heavy stacks can compress transfers unevenly, especially when stored for weeks.

Simple prevention steps include:

  • Keeping transfers covered or enclosed
  • Separating large orders with backing sheets
  • Never stacking heavy objects on top of stored transfers
DTF transfers stored in protective storage box

Step 5: Label and Rotate Transfers by Order Date

Many people ask if DTF transfers expire. The answer is that they do not have a fixed expiration date, but they do age. Adhesive performance and print quality can decline gradually over time, especially if storage conditions are not ideal.

Label each batch with the order date and use older transfers first. This first in, first out approach helps you avoid pressing transfers that have quietly passed their optimal window.

If you ever notice performance differences between batches, labeling makes it much easier to identify whether storage time played a role.

Common Questions About DTF Transfer Storage

How long do DTF transfers last in storage?

When stored flat, dry, and at stable room temperature, many DTF transfers can last for weeks or longer. Actual lifespan depends heavily on storage conditions.

Do DTF transfers expire?

DTF transfers do not expire on a specific date, but they can degrade over time. Adhesion issues are more likely as storage time increases.

Is it better to store DTF transfers flat or rolled?

Flat storage is always preferred. Rolling increases the risk of curl memory and uneven pressure during pressing.

What humidity level is bad for DTF transfers?

Consistently damp environments are problematic. Dry, stable indoor air is ideal for DTF transfer storage.

Can I store DTF transfers in a garage?

Only if temperature and humidity are controlled. Most garages experience large swings that shorten transfer lifespan.

Can bent DTF transfers still be used?

Minor bends may still press acceptably, but creases often lead to cracking or weak adhesion.

Should I reseal transfers after opening the package?

Yes. Resealing transfers helps protect them from humidity and dust, especially for longer storage periods.

How can I tell if storage damaged my transfers?

Warning signs include tacky surfaces, uneven texture, dull colors, or inconsistent adhesion during pressing.

Final Thoughts on DTF Transfer Storage

Good DTF transfer storage is about prevention. Most problems blamed on pressing are actually storage issues that happened days or weeks earlier. Keeping transfers flat, dry, and stable protects the work you already paid for.
